How Laundry Room Water Damage Restoration Actually Works

With laundry room water damage restoration, our team follows a meticulous process to ensure your property is restored to its original condition. We’ll assess the damage, extract standing water, dry your laundry room, and apply specialized cleaning products to remove any remaining moisture and bacteria. Our team uses advanced equipment, including industrial-grade pumps, air movers, and dehumidifiers, to ensure the job is done efficiently and effectively.

Step 1: Assessment and Inspection

Our team will conduct a thorough assessment of the damage, identifying the source of the leak and the extent of the water damage. We’ll take note of any affected materials, including drywall, flooring, and cabinets, and develop a plan to restore your laundry room to its original condition.

Step 2: Water Extraction

Using industrial-grade pumps, we’ll extract standing water from your laundry room, reducing the risk of further damage and ensuring your safety.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

We’ll use air movers and dehumidifiers to dry your laundry room, removing any remaining moisture and preventing the growth of mold and mildew.

Step 4: Cleaning and Disinfecting

Our team will apply specialized cleaning products to remove any remaining bacteria, viruses, and other contaminants from your laundry room.

Step 5: Restoration and Repair

We’ll repair or replace any damaged materials, including drywall, flooring, and cabinets, to restore your laundry room to its original condition.

Laundry Room Water Damage Restoration Cost in Brogan, OR

The cost of laundry room water damage restoration can vary depending on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ions in Brogan, OR.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, type of flooring, and equipment needed
Drying and D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, type of flooring, and equipment needed
Cleaning and Disinfecting $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, type of flooring, and equipment needed
Restoration and Repair $1,000 – $10,000 Size of affected area, type of materials damaged, and labor required
Insurance Claims Help $0 – $500 Complexity of insurance claims process and number of claims
